How To Call Another Alexa Device In A Different House?

Is it possible to call another Alexa device in a different household? The answer is yes, and here’s how you can do it.

Using Drop In Feature

One way to communicate with another Alexa device in a different house is by using the Drop In feature. If the device you want to connect to is in the same household, you can simply say, “Alexa, Drop In on [device name].” This will establish a two-way audio connection.

Calling External Alexa Devices

When trying to call an Alexa device in a different household, the process is slightly different. You can say, “Alexa, Drop In on [contact name]” to connect to an external Alexa device. This feature allows you to communicate with friends and family who have given you permission to Drop In on their device.

Permissions and Privacy

It’s important to note that Drop In feature requires permissions and settings to be properly configured. The owner of the Alexa device you want to call must enable Drop In and grant you permission to connect to their device. This ensures privacy and security when using this feature.

Setting Up Drop In

To enable Drop In on your Alexa device, you can do so through the Alexa app. Go to the settings for the device you want to enable Drop In on, and then select the Drop In feature. From there, you can customize who has permission to Drop In on your device.

Announcing Your Presence

When you Drop In on another Alexa device, the device will announce your presence with a chime. This alerts the owners of the device that you have connected and are ready to communicate. It’s a helpful feature to ensure transparency in the communication process.

Ending the Call

Once you have finished your conversation with the other Alexa device, you can end the call by saying, “Alexa, hang up.” This will disconnect the audio connection and ensure privacy when not actively communicating via Drop In.
